Arturia MicroBrute Could Be That One Monosynth You’re After

The inclusion of a built-in sequencer in such a compact unit means that you can carry it around and play with new ideas as you travel, without having to depend on a laptop.

The modulation matrix, on the other hand, allows you to send LFO and Control Voltage signal that affect various sound parameters such as pitch, filter and PWM.

Another cool thing is the inclusion of a filter unit bearing the name of the infamous Steiner-Parker. A fresh take especially when considering the fact that other manufacturers usually go for the Moog filter.
